PBR Canada: Triplett Wins PBR Canada Touring Pro Division Event in Calgary

By: Ted Stovin
June 15, 2017

Matt Triplett is currently No. 8 in the world standings. Photo: Andy Watson / BullStockMedia.com

CALGARY, Alta. – Matt Triplett (Columbia Falls, Montana) earned his first PBR Canada victory of 2017 at the Global Petroleum Show stop on the PBR Canada Touring Pro Division schedule.

Triplett won Round 1 with an 85-point ride on Body Special (Outlaw Buckers Rodeo Corp). In the championship round, the current No. 8 man in the PBR world standings put up 86.5 points on Shakin’ Hands.

Overall, Triplett edged second place Edgar Durazo (Montezuma, Mexico) by a single point to claim the $2,775.03 and 60 world points. Durazo put together scores of 84 points in Round 1 on Whiskey Hand (Vold/Prescott), and 86.5 points on Mr. Sunshine in the championship round to take home $2,096.31.08 and 30 world points.

Tanner Byrne was bucked off in his return to competition.

Third on the night went to Brock Radford (DeWinton, Alberta). Radford scored 81.5 points on Gran Torino (Girletz Rodeo Stock) in Round 1, and 87 points on Case Closed (Outlaw Buckers Rodeo Corp) in the championship round. For his work, Radford earned $1,358.35 and 20 world points.

Dakota Buttar, the current top Canadian in the PBR world standings, finished in the fourth spot in Calgary. Buttar put up 83.5 points on Lace Up (Girletz Rodeo Stock) in Round 1, but was bucked off by Moves Like Pozzy (Vold/Prescott) in the final round. Coming into Wednesday, Buttar had no points in the PBR Canada National Standings, but he will leave Stampede Park with $798.77 and 15 world points.

Rounding out the Top 6 in Calgary were Cody Coverchuk (Meadow Lake, Saskatchewan) and Cody Casper (Pacific, Washington) in fifth and sixth respectively. Coverchuk earned $455.42 and 10 world points, while Casper netted $297.50 and 5 world points.

The 2017 PBR Canada Touring Pro Division next heads to Wanham, Alberta, for the Wanham PBR Extravaganza on Friday June 16th starting at 7:30pm.
